Job Responsibilities

CORE RESPONSIBILITIES

•Perform all activities related to processing and analyzing biological samples.

•Documents the activities related to sample analysis and assist in verifying various documents.

•Initiate analysis runs using the appropriate instruments and software.

•Follows-up on result analysis and assists in finding solutions to bioanalytical issues.

•Assist in eliminating the chemical and biological waste generated by laboratory employees and helps clean laboratory equipment and instruments.

•Perform support tasks to meet the needs of laboratory users.

•Responsible for performing activities that are in compliance with applicable Corporate and Divisional Policies, Standard Operating Procedures and Operating Guidelines and performing other duties as assigned by management.

QUALIFICATIONS

•Bachelors or College Degree in Science.

•Must demonstrate good computer skills especially in the utilization of Microsoft Word, Excel and analytical software.

•Basic understanding of the requirements of analytical chemistry.

•English level (Quebec specific); required bilingualism includes understanding simple messages and following basic instructions.

•Relative alternate certification may be considered acceptable.
